Decreasing overgrown plants is a crucial aspect of landscape management, helping to restore order, enhance aesthetic app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ict air flow, reduce sunlight penetration, and produce chances for pests and illness. Pruning and thinning are the primary approaches for managing thick or rowdy vegetation, enabling plants to grow while maintaining a controlled look. The process involves sel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ural development habit of each species. Timing is vital; some plants react best to pruning during dormancy, while blooming ranges might require post-bloom cutting to maintain blooms. Appropriate technique guarantees cuts are tidy and located to encourage healthy brand-new development. In addition to boosting plant health, decreasing overgrowth enhances ease of access and presence in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outdoor home end up being safer and more welcoming. Long-term upkeep plans prevent future overgrowth, guaranteeing a well balanced and harmonious landscape.
